The Assistant Police Chief of Prague and his wife have been arrested on numerous counts of child sexual abuse and physical abuse.
Jeffrey Louis Frisbie, 55, longtime Prague police officer and his wife Kimberly Ann Frisbie, 50, were taken into custody and taken to the Lincoln County jail. Each immediately posted $100,00 bonds and they have been released from jail.
They have been ordered to make their initial appearances in court at 1 p.m. Sep. 26.
Prague city officials confirmed that Frisbie is currently on administrative leave.
Even though no formal charges have been filed in Lincoln County District Court, a probable cause affidavit for issuance of felony arrest warrant lists two counts of first degree rape again Jeff Frisbie and 22 counts of lewd counts with a child under 16.
The affidavit of probable cause for issuance of felony arrest warrant for Kimberly Ann Frisbie lists 17 counts of physical child abuse against her.
District Attorney Adam Panter said while he expects formal charges to be filed against the pair sometime this week, he is not certain about the date.
Panter issued this statement following the arrest of the pair.
“After a swift and aggressive investigation conducted by investigators with the District 23 District Attorney’s Office, the City of Prague Assistant Chief of Police, Jeff Frisbie and his wife Kim Frisbie were arrested for numerous counts of child sexual abuse and physical abuse. The fact that one of the arrested was a member of law enforcement, in a position of trust within the community, is both disappointing and appalling.
“Despite this, my office is committed to seeking justice without taking into consideration a perpetrator’s profession or social status.
“While I am unable to comment on the details of the investigation, I can say that we look forward to presenting the evidence in a court of law in an effort to ensure justice on behalf of the victims and for the State of Oklahoma.”
